System and Software for Interlinking Responses of Mobile Cellular Devices to Create a Communal Response to a Single Directive

First Claim
Patent Images

1. A method of operating a plurality of mobile cellular devices held by different users in a synchronized manner, wherein each of said plurality of mobile cellular devices has a system clock, a display screen, a camera flash, and communicates with a communications network, said method comprising the steps of:

  • loading a software application onto each of said plurality of mobile cellular devices that enable a lead user from among any of said users of said plurality of mobile cellular devices to select an event and to select a session activity to be performed by said plurality of mobile cellular devices during said event;

    running said software application in said plurality of mobile cellular devices, wherein upon running said software application, each of said plurality of mobile cellular devices first updates said system clock through said communications network, therein creating improved time synchronization between each said system clock in said plurality of mobile cellular devices;

    wherein said software application enables each of said users to agree to participate in said session activity and become part of a user pool;

    wherein said software application enables said lead user to set an execution time for said session activity; and

    wherein at said execution time, said session activity is performed simultaneously by all of said plurality of mobile cellular devices held by said users in said user pool.
